So, what are cooling means? They refer specifically to techniques used by fire suppression personnel to take the heat out of the equation. By lowering the temperature of the fuels involved—think trees, grass, and other combustibles—they can effectively inhibit the combustion process. The Nuts and Bolts of Fire Suppression Techniques

In the frantic dance against wildfires, fire suppression teams employ a variety of strategies, all revolving around this crucial concept of cooling means. Here’s a peek into a few methods:

  • Water Application: Okay, so it’s the classic approach, but don’t underestimate the power of water. By dousing flames and hot spots, firefighters not only cool the burning materials but also create a barrier against the fire's advance. Think of it as the first aid of firefighting. The more water you apply, the quicker those flames simmer down.

  • Foam Agents: These aren’t your typical soapy bubbles! Firefighting foams smother the fire while cooling down the surfaces. They can be especially effective on flammable liquids, creating a barrier that prevents oxygen from fueling the blaze.

  • Fire Retardants: This is where things get a bit technical. Fire retardants are chemical mixtures designed to coat and cool materials, making them less likely to ignite. They worked their magic during the major wildfires spread across the West Coast, saving countless properties and lives.
